El Hub and I are meeting my bro and his girlfriend for Korean barbecue (yup, Korean barbecue in San Francisco’s Japantown), and if we can get there early enough, I hope to visit Kinokuniya Bookstore, which is this huge bookstore filled with Japanese books — everything from business books to art, anime and manga, children’s literature, and an awesome magazine section with literally hundreds of titles.
I can’t read many of them, ya know, except for the few that are in English, but I love looking at the pictures. The fashion, photography and art mags are my faves.

Oh! — I’ve got a movie rental recommendation for you. It’s called The Way, starring Martin Sheen. It’s about a father who heads overseas to recover the body of his estranged son who died while traveling the “El camino de Santiago,” and decides to take the pilgrimage himself.
Just a wonderful film (found it on Netflix) that warmed my heart and also made me really want to take a trip to Europe.
